Shares of Conagra Brands (CAG) have faced significant downward pressure, with the stock price recently sliding to $15.60. This decline marks a period of notable weakness for the consumer staples company as it struggles to keep pace with wider market gains. Over the past six months, the equity has shed more than 16% of its value. This trend highlights a growing divergence between Conagra's performance and the broader equity indices, suggesting that investors are reassessing the company's current valuation and growth trajectory.
